Post-Audit Surprises: Why Your Revenue Reports Aren’t the Final Word
Retailer audits often reach 12 to 24 months back. That means a “clean” month can come back to haunt you if an auditor uncovers a compliance issue or documentation gap. It’s like getting a bill for a party you thought someone else already paid for.

Your Retail Partner Isn’t Out to Get You—But Their Systems Might Be
Here’s the truth—retailers aren’t trying to cheat you. But their systems are often a different story. Most deductions are triggered automatically by software scanning for any deviation from thousands of rules. A mislabeled pallet? A misread barcode? Even something as small as an EDI mismatch can set off a chain reaction.

SNAP Shake‑Ups & What They Mean for Retail Suppliers
The 2025 “One Big Beautiful Bill” puts $186 billion in SNAP cuts on the table over the next decade. Starting in 2028, states begin covering 5–15% of benefit costs based on their error rate, up from zero, and must pick up 75% of administrative costs instead of 50%.
